Cannon Barrage
Sold out
from Original price
Original price
$0.39
from $0.39
Current price
$0.39
REACTION (Play any time, even before spells and abilities resolve.)
Deal 2 to all enemy units in combat.
Deal 2 to all enemy units in combat.